What you'll be doing:
- Design, develop, and unit test updates to existing application functionality and/or new features and modules within Envision’s product suite
- Complete user interface tasks primarily using C#, JavaScript, and the .NET framework
- Complete database tasks using T-SQL and SQL Server 2019+ via EF and/or stored procedures
- Ensure all web applications meet Section 508 and WCAG accessibility standards
- Conduct accessibility testing and remediation using tools like AXE, JAWS, and WAVE
- Optimize web applications for performance, scalability, and security
- Include Automated Testing in tools like Jasmine, Jest, Playwright, etc.
- Generate technical documentation as applicable
- Provide architectural guidance and development for Web technologies such as Bootstrap, JQuery, Knockout, etc.
- Work with customers and/or other team members to complete technical design tasks
- Support system, integration, and end user testing as necessary
- Collaborate with customers and other team members on ideas, designs, and issues (both technical and non-technical)
What we're looking for:
- Bachelor’s degree or equivalent in Computer Science, Information Technology, or equivalent AND 0-3 years’ experience in the field or related area OR 3-6 years if experience in the field or related area in lieu of degree. 1+ years of native Azure cloud development
- 5+ years of web application development experience
- 4+ years of experience with C# and the .NET 4.x and above Framework, .NET core, MVC and WebForms
- 3+ years of experience with JavaScript and related technologies
- 3+ years of experience with Client-side technologies, e.g., HTML5, CSS
- 2+ years of development experience using T-SQL and/or EF
- 2+ years of experience with Microsoft SQL Server 2019 or later
- 4+ years of experience with Microsoft Visual Studio or VSCode
- Hands-on experience with 508 compliance, WCAG 2.1 guidelines, and ARIA roles
- Familiarity with accessibility testing tools (e.g., AXE, WAVE, JAWS, NVDA)
- Experience in full life cycle process of web application development including technical requirements gathering, documentation, and testing
- Solid understanding of Object-Oriented Programming and Design concepts
- Microsoft Azure Dev Ops
- Self-starter willing to work in a dynamic environment with minimal supervision
- Ability to produce high quality work in a timely fashion
- Ability to quickly understand the existing systems and analyze the system impact of changes
- Ability to troubleshoot issues
- Strong analytical and problem-solving skills
- Effective spoken and written communication skills
- Self-motivated to learn and keep up with the latest technologies, tools, and industry trends
What will make you stand out?
- Multi-tier application development experience
- Serverless Cloud architecture experience
- API development: Azure API Gateway, Open API, Swagger, Azure Front Door
- Infrastructure as Code experience
- Azure Monitoring and Management solutions: Azure Analytics, Application Insights, Automation, Azure Monitor, Azure Workbooks, Dashboards
- Best Practices such as Azure Cloud Adoption Framework, Azure Well-Architected Framework, Azure Architecture Center
- Shift-left practices with security, observability, testing, code quality checks, documentation, etc.
- Documentation and modeling experience: C4 Model, Arc42
Similar Jobs
What We Do
InductiveHealth Informatics helps to keep people safe from infectious disease by solving complex public health technology problems for governments around the globe. Based in Atlanta, Georgia, InductiveHealth’s work can be seen in the United States supporting State and Federal health agencies, in Africa supporting PEPFAR and Global Fund initiatives, and elsewhere globally, delivering some of the most complex technology efforts in public health. Over a dozen states, jurisdictions, and foreign national governments entrust their systems and data to InductiveHealth.
InductiveHealth’s technology is implemented to rigorous US Federal Government standards for information security, in compliance with FISMA, HIPAA, and HITECH standards. InductiveHealth manages more clinical-to-public health integrations than any other firm, providing leading capabilities and advanced technology to understand and combat the spread of infectious disease